Analogue Logic: The Householder Topology
While most modern reverbs rely on DSP, Placeholder is an all-analogue implementation of a digital algorithm. By utilizing BBDs (Bucket Brigade Devices), VCAs, and discrete mixers within a Householder topology, Placeholder achieves rapid echo density using only three delay lines.

The result is a complex, shifting “room” sound that maintains the grit, noise, and organic “magic” that only a true analogue signal path can provide.

A type of reverb that sits between the mechanical and algorithmic devices of yesteryears. Creating uncanny liminal spaces, reminiscent of a time that never was. A time that is now. This is not a delay that sounds like reverb, but a reverb that sometimes sounds like a delay. Yes, the signal path is all analogue. Expect noise and that magic we all love. Placeholder is an analogue implementation of a digital reverb algorithm using BBDs, mixers, VCAs and simple yet tasty filters. The topology in question is called Householder, allowing quick echo density even with only three delay-lines. There’s no denying the power of algorithmic representation of our daily activities.
